English term or phrase: Battersea Park Scheme
Thomas Cubitt was one of the organizers of the Battersea Park Scheme and was a guarantor of the Great Exhibition(大英博览会奖) of 1851, as well as a major contributor to the preparation of the Metropolitan Buildings Act(《都会建筑法案》)of 1855.
